Ground Casualty
SP4 Jeffery L. Wright was trained in field artillery and served with C Battery, 5th Battalion, 42nd Artillery. While deployed to Vietnam, SP4 Wright became ill with malaria. He was hospitalized at Long Binh Post in Bien Hoa Province, RVN, when on September 30, 1971, he suffered a fatal heart attack as a consequence of his illness. He was 18 years-old. [Taken from coffeltdatabase.org]
